Using digital
platforms in order to
support oral work such
as Drive, Teams and
OneNote
Using a visualiser to
display examples of
students’ work in an
effort to allow for peer
interaction without
swapping work
Have lollipop
sticks or names on
paper to pick at random
as students are less
condent when
wearing a mask
Improving French
listening skills
by using the website
newsinslowfrench
TTS Reader:
converts text to
speech to help with
pronunciation
Recording oral
feedback for
students because it is
individualised,
meaningful and time
effective
Tech tips including
voice ampliers
and graphic pads
Using a screen
recorder (Loom) or
voiceover to feedback
orally on pieces
of work
Escape rooms,
but use the ones
already made,
otherwise it is too
time consuming
Doing more
self-correction with
students to build
their autonomous
learning skills
Encouraging student
to use Teams to practice
oral work, especially if
some of them are absent
due to being deemed a
close contact
Liveworksheets.com
Using mini
whiteboards at the start
of class for vocab
revision and bingo to
give teachers a chance to
set up after moving
classroom
Text to speech
naturalreaders.com/online
Part of assignment, a %
added for students
correcting and analysing
the feedback given by the
teacher, then they get
their nal grade
